How they compare
WB: Lower Middle Income (july 2025) currently reports 57.45 million against 1.63 million in Japan, a difference of 55.82 million.
That makes WB: Lower Middle Income (july 2025)'s figure about 35.3 times Japan's.
Across all 15 years both countries report, WB: Lower Middle Income (july 2025) has been ahead every year.
Japan ranks 17th and WB: Lower Middle Income (july 2025) ranks 16th of 196 countries.
WB: Lower Middle Income (july 2025) has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
